Cisco is a multinational technology company that provides networking hardware, software, and services to enterprises, service providers, and governments. It builds routers, switches, optical transceivers, programmable silicon, and edge computing platforms, and offers security, collaboration (Webex), observability, and AI-enabled software and support services to help organizations design, operate, and secure large-scale networks and data centers. Cisco also delivers professional services, training, and cloud-managed solutions to support digital transformation and AI-ready infrastructure.
